Vue.js 菜鸟教程:从零开始,掌握网页开发新技能!

2024-05-17 16:42:24 浏览数 (1089)

vue.js图标 的图像结果

你是否也对网页开发充满了兴趣,却不知从何下手?别担心,Vue.js 就是你的最佳选择!它就像搭积木一样,让你轻松构建出各种网页界面,即使是零基础的小白也能快速上手。

1. 为什么选择Vue.js?

Vue.js 是一款轻量级、可扩展的 JavaScript 框架,简单易学,功能强大,拥有庞大的社区和丰富的资源,是初学者的理想选择。

  • 简单易学: Vue.js 的语法简洁明了,易于理解,学习曲线平缓,即使没有编程基础也能轻松入门。
  • 灵活高效: 它可以根据你的需求,灵活地调整网页的结构和功能,帮助你快速开发出各种酷炫的网页应用。
  • 强大的生态系统: 有许多优秀的功能库和工具可以帮助你开发更复杂的应用,例如 Vue Router 用于页面路由,Vuex 用于状态管理等。

2.  你需要掌握哪些知识?

为了顺利开启你的 Vue.js 学习之旅,你需要掌握以下几个关键知识点:

2.1  基础知识

  • HTML、CSS、JavaScript: 这是网页开发的基础,你需要对它们有一定的了解,才能理解 Vue.js 的工作原理。
  • Vue.js 的核心概念: 包括模板语法、数据绑定、组件化、指令等。
  • Vue.js 的基本语法: 掌握 Vue.js 的语法,才能编写出正确的代码。

2.2  重要功能

  • 组件化开发: 组件是 Vue.js 的核心概念,它允许你将用户界面拆分成独立、可复用的组件,提高代码的可维护性和复用性。
  • 数据绑定: Vue.js 的数据绑定机制,可以将数据和视图关联起来,当数据发生改变时,视图会自动更新。
  • 事件处理: 允许你监听用户操作,例如点击、鼠标悬停等事件,并执行相应的代码。
  • 路由: Vue Router 可以帮助你构建单页应用(SPA),实现页面之间的跳转。
  • 状态管理: Vuex 可以帮助你管理复杂应用中的数据,使数据在不同组件之间共享。

3.  如何学习 Vue.js?

  • 官方文档: Vue.js 的官方文档非常详细,涵盖了所有你需要学习的内容。
  • 在线教程: 网上有很多优秀的 Vue.js 在线教程,可以帮助你快速入门。
  • 实战项目:  尝试构建一些简单的 Vue.js 应用,例如个人博客、待办事项列表等,在实践中学习和巩固知识。
  • 社区交流:  加入 Vue.js 社区,与其他开发者交流学习,解决遇到的问题。

4.  学习路线建议

  • 基础入门: 学习 HTML、CSS、JavaScript 的基础知识,并了解 Vue.js 的核心概念和基本语法。
  • 组件化开发: 学习如何创建和使用组件,并掌握数据绑定和事件处理等功能。
  • 路由和状态管理: 学习 Vue Router 和 Vuex,构建更复杂的应用。
  • 实战项目:  尝试构建一些简单的 Vue.js 应用,并将其部署到线上。

5.  总结

Vue.js 是一个功能强大、简单易学的框架,它可以帮助你快速构建出各种网页应用。只要掌握了基础知识和关键功能,你就能轻松开启你的网页开发之旅,创造出属于你的精彩作品!

记住,学习的过程就像搭积木一样,一步一步积累,你就能建造出属于你的精彩世界!